Wat is de functie van een microcontroller?

In dit artikel leren we je over microcontrollers en hun betekenis in de moderne elektronica. Het begrijpen van de functies en werkingen van microcontrollers is essentieel voor iedereen die geïnteresseerd is in embedded systemen, robotica en elektronisch ontwerp.

Wat is de functie van een microcontroller?

De primaire functie van een microcontroller is om te dienen als een compact geïntegreerd circuit dat is ontworpen om specifieke bewerkingen binnen ingebedde systemen te besturen. Microcontrollers kunnen gegevens verwerken, verschillende randapparatuur besturen en vooraf gedefinieerde taken uitvoeren op basis van invoer van sensoren of gebruikersopdrachten. Ze worden vaak gebruikt in verschillende toepassingen, zoals autosystemen, huishoudelijke apparaten, medische apparaten en consumentenelektronica, waar ze functies uitvoeren zoals het monitoren, controleren en verwerken van gegevens.

Hoe werkt een microcontroller?

Een microcontroller werkt door een reeks instructies uit te voeren die in zijn geheugen zijn opgeslagen. De basisarchitectuur omvat een centrale verwerkingseenheid (CPU), geheugen (zowel RAM als ROM) en invoer-/uitvoerpoorten (I/O). De CPU haalt instructies op uit het programma dat in het geheugen is opgeslagen en voert deze uit, verwerkt invoersignalen en verzendt uitvoersignalen om andere apparaten te besturen. Microcontrollers maken gebruik van verschillende randapparatuur, zoals timers, analoog-digitaalomzetters (ADC’s) en communicatie-interfaces, om effectief met de externe omgeving te communiceren.

Wat wordt bedoeld met stroomdiagram?

Waar bevindt zich een microcontroller?

Microcontrollers worden doorgaans aangetroffen in verschillende elektronische apparaten en systemen. Ze zijn geïntegreerd in printplaten als onderdeel van ingebedde systemen, waardoor apparaten geautomatiseerde taken kunnen uitvoeren. Veel voorkomende locaties voor microcontrollers zijn onder meer huishoudelijke apparaten zoals magnetrons en wasmachines, autosystemen voor motorbediening en veiligheidsvoorzieningen, en consumentenelektronica zoals televisies en gameconsoles. Door hun compacte formaat kunnen ze in vrijwel elk elektronisch product worden ingebed, waardoor ze alomtegenwoordig zijn in de moderne technologie.

Wat is de functie van een microprocessor?

Hoewel zowel microcontrollers als microprocessors essentieel zijn bij computergebruik, verschillen hun functies. Een microprocessor fungeert als de centrale verwerkingseenheid van een computersysteem en voert een breed scala aan complexe taken en berekeningen uit. Het richt zich op computergebruik voor algemene doeleinden en is ontworpen voor het beheren van bewerkingen op hoog niveau, zoals het uitvoeren van besturingssystemen en applicaties. Een microcontroller is daarentegen ontworpen voor specifieke besturingstaken en bevat doorgaans extra functies zoals ingebouwd geheugen en I/O-poorten die zijn afgestemd op ingebedde toepassingen.

Wat zijn timers en wat is hun functie?

Hoe wordt een microcontroller geprogrammeerd?

Microcontrollers worden geprogrammeerd met behulp van specifieke programmeertalen, meestal C of assembleertaal. Het programmeerproces omvat het schrijven van code die het gewenste gedrag van de microcontroller definieert, het compileren van de code en het uploaden ervan naar het geheugen van de microcontroller via een programmeur of ontwikkelbord. Er zijn verschillende Integrated Development Environments (IDE’s) beschikbaar om dit proces te vergemakkelijken en tools te bieden voor het schrijven, debuggen en testen van de code. Eenmaal geprogrammeerd voert de microcontroller de instructies herhaaldelijk uit om de toegewezen taken uit te voeren.

Wat is een spanningsregelaar en waarvoor wordt deze gebruikt?

We hopen dat deze uitleg u helpt een beter begrip te krijgen van microcontrollers, hun functies en hun belang in de moderne elektronica. Naarmate de technologie zich blijft ontwikkelen, zal de rol van microcontrollers waarschijnlijk toenemen, waardoor ze essentiële componenten worden in verschillende toepassingen.

QR Code
📱